FDA Grants Breakthrough Device Designation to Aurenar's Investigational V-Link System for Cerebral Vasospasm After Aneurysmal Subarachnoid Hemorrhage

The Food and Drug Administration (FDA) has granted Breakthrough Device Designation to the V-Link System (Aurenar, St. Louis, MS), an investigational, noninvasive transauricular vagus nerve stimulation (taVNS) device being developed as an adjunct to standard clinical management to reduce the incidence of cerebral vasospasm in adults aged 22 years and older with aneurysmal subarachnoid hemorrhage during intensive care. Cerebral vasospasm is a major contributor to secondary brain injury, disability, and death following aSAH, and there are currently no FDA-approved device therapies designed to prevent this complication.
The FDA's Breakthrough Devices Program is intended to expedite the development and regulatory review of medical devices that may offer more effective treatment for life-threatening or irreversibly debilitating conditions. According to Aurenar, the designation provides priority engagement with the FDA as the company advances V-Link through pivotal clinical development and the premarket review process. V-Link is a wireless, noninvasive device that delivers low-energy electrical stimulation to a branch of the vagus nerve through the outer ear with the goal of modulating inflammatory pathways implicated in secondary brain injury after hemorrhagic stroke.
What the Early Data Showed
- In a randomized clinical trial of 27 participants with subarachnoid hemorrhage, taVNS reduced moderate-to-severe cerebral vasospasm by more than 40%, according to the company.
- Investigators reported no associated adverse events related to the therapy.
- A companion analysis found a 20% reduction in 30-day hospitalization costs associated with the treatment approach.
The company stated that it plans to continue development of V-Link and evaluate additional critical care applications for its neuromodulation platform.
